Career Development


Whether you want a new job in the same field, or want to develop a new career direction, I will be happy to help. I offer my clients reliable and valid interest inventories and creative strategies for skill identification, as well as the most extensive interactive database in the U.S. for current information about nearly 1,000 occupations, O*NET™ Online. I also offer extensive assistance with resume-writing and interviewing skills, and, perhaps most importantly, crucial guidance and moral support throughout the job-seeking process.

Stress Management/Life Balance

Women are the busiest people I know, often balancing child-rearing, employment, elder care, relationship with a partner, and a host of other responsibilities. I work with many clients who want to learn how to relax and stay in balance in their busy lives. I teach clients the skills of relaxation that support physical, emotional, and mental well-being and overall enjoyment of life. Depending on your needs and preferences, this may include deep breathing, mindfulness, guided meditation, assertiveness, gratitude practices, Qi Gong (the ancient Chinese practice that works with energy), and many other approaches.

How Coaching Works

I welcome prospective clients to contact me by email or phone for initial exploration of your needs and fee information. In our first one-hour session, I’ll gather additional information from you. At the end of it, I will outline a plan describing the individualized services I recommend and an approximate timeline. I meet with most clients weekly or biweekly, whichever is best to support your momentum toward achieving your goals. I usually give homework between sessions and like to receive a progress report from you at the start of each meeting. I do all that I can to support your moving forward toward your goals.
